#370968 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#370968 is composed of 21.6% red, 3.5% green and 40.8%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 47.1% cyan, 91.3% magenta, 0% yellow and 59.2% black. It has a hue angle of 269.1 degrees, a saturation of 84.1% and a lightness of 22.2%. #370968 color hex could be obtained by blending #6e12d0 with #000000. Closest websafe color is: #330066.

● #370968 color description : Very dark violet.
#370968 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#370968 has RGB values of R:55, G:9, B:104 and CMYK values of C:0.47, M:0.91, Y:0, K:0.59. Its decimal value is 3606888.
